Output 21eeeb70767ecf89b18d734c5ab04f712456b2e007773c6872a2694124d92047:4

value
80593868
script pubkey
OP_0 OP_PUSHBYTES_32 319c5323badacdb263e73d37cf07421fddf9bd2124c3109ee4c67081d643e3d2
address
bc1qxxw9xga6mtxmycl885mu7p6zrlwln0fpynp3p8hycecgr4jru0fqw9u8s6
transaction
21eeeb70767ecf89b18d734c5ab04f712456b2e007773c6872a2694124d92047
spent
true